A busy computer consumes more power at idle than one at idle, while idle requires more power than standby or hibernation. There is a lot of confusion between the terms standby, hibernation, and deep sleep mode. For a good reason. How they work varies by operating system and computer manufacturer!
There is no industry standard meaning for these terms. I will use the definitions of the US Department of Energy. These recognize two different states: idle state and standby. Hibernate means that the computer saves its status and then turns itself off. It will reload its status when you turn it back on.
